-slower respawn time for the loosing team allow to precipitate the outcome of the game.
-as for the nades in many cases they where just blurring the gameplay in my opinion (and the demo still has his GL if you want nades)
-the medic need to be able to follow an HWGuy/Pyro/Soldier in order to support them, no need to have two scout classes.

The HW gatling gun overheating is the biggest joke i've ever seen in FF, even if we consider just the suspension of disbelief (yeah a guy wielding a Gatling canon isn't exactly realistic)
Maybe i'm the only one that know this but the Gatling canon system is designed for two things:
-Shoot faster
-DO NOT Overheat!

I personally have been quite pleased by this TF2 beta, i like the look and feel, it's relaxing my eyes and the players really stand out from the background.

The new medic is really interesting and re balance the game and put back the scout at the position of flag capper/runner. Wich wasn't the medic job (yeah , remember medic is supposed to be a support class)

If you've been plowing into the audio commentaries it seems they have been asking themselve a lot of questions and made a lot of decisions to make TF2 more "competition oriented", now matches have a finite time (wich isn't just the map cycle time) and after this time , one team win and another lose. This is great for tournaments as we can foresee the length of each match.

To me valve took TFC and scraped from it the little "tricks" that where unbalancing the classes. They also made the combat cleaner (no more grenade spam) .

I've played FF a bit, it looks nice, it feels nice, there is a few bugs here and there and that's okay. But for me it got designed mainly for the "leet" tfc players that will use the little tricks to get an edge on the newbies.

I prefere TF2 because everybody has the same tools and knowledges and the winning team will be organised and able to adapt and anticipate their enemy, rather than being based on who can perform this or that twitch skill.

I did not like TF2 very much. It's not because it was a bad game, but because I already had a game on steam that played like it, and it was called Day of Defeat. If you think I'm crazy, try playing dust bowl and tell me it does not feel the same as playing a point control map on DoD.

I always loved TFC because of the fast pace game play, and after striping out the armor, nades, and speeds, (The pyro does not move as fast as he does in FF or TFC), the game feels slower. Is it more team oriented? Maybe, but it does not feel any more team oriented then when someone needs to sneak into another base to disable an SG, or when an engineer needs to toss an EMP at a stack of pipe bombs.

There are a lot of neat features, such as getting a nemesis after being killed too many times, but THATS not why I play fortress games, I enjoy the fast pace and total mayhem that goes on, and thats something I don't see in TF2.
